SmartFoxServer 2X is a comprehensive platform for rapidly developing multi-user applications and games. It offers a rich set of features, impressive documentation, and a free 100 CCU license. This demo project is the first in a series of three, teaching you how to create a lobby application for multiplayer game development. The lobby is a staging area where players can customize their profile, chat with friends, search for a game to join, and more. The project includes three scenes: Login, Lobby, and Game. The Lobby scene is the core of the example, where active games can be joined or a new game can be launched. The Game scene acts as a placeholder for an actual game, showing how to implement an in-game chat.
SmartFoxServer 2X features include a high-performance network engine, binary protocol with dynamic compression, secure encrypted login system, and more. It supports all platforms supported by Unity, Windows, Linux/Unix, and macOS (10.8+). The platform also includes a web-based administration tool, embedded web server, and direct database connectivity.





